Fort Lauderdale blends coastal living with a laid-back boating culture, earning its nickname as the Venice of America thanks to miles of scenic waterways. Las Olas Boulevard offers dining and shopping, while the city's sunny climate and proximity to Miami make it appealing for nurses seeking a vibrant South Florida lifestyle.

Worth asking
We can’t answer these from the listing we have. Good ones to ask a recruiter or in the interview.
- Can you walk me through base pay range and differentials?
- What should I expect for shifts, weekly hours, weekend, holiday, call, and rotation?
- What orientation, preceptor time, and ongoing unit support are included?
- How are patient load, floating, and staffing support handled day to day?
